tests/server/bags_api.rs Normal file
View file

@ -0,0 +1,246 @@
use crate::helpers::{
create_default_roast, create_default_roaster, spawn_app, spawn_app_with_auth,
};
use brewlog::domain::bags::{Bag, BagWithRoast, NewBag, UpdateBag};
use chrono::NaiveDate;
#[tokio::test]
async fn creating_a_bag_returns_a_201_for_valid_data() {
// Arrange
let app = spawn_app_with_auth().await;
let roaster = create_default_roaster(&app).await;
let roast = create_default_roast(&app, roaster.id).await;
let client = reqwest::Client::new();
let new_bag = NewBag {
roast_id: roast.id,
roast_date: Some(NaiveDate::from_ymd_opt(2023, 1, 1).unwrap()),
amount: 250.0,
};
// Act
let response = client
.post(app.api_url("/bags"))
.bearer_auth(app.auth_token.as_ref().unwrap())
.json(&new_bag)
.send()
.await
.expect("Failed to execute request");
// Assert
assert_eq!(response.status(), 201);
let bag: Bag = response.json().await.expect("Failed to parse response");
assert_eq!(bag.roast_id, roast.id);
assert_eq!(bag.amount, 250.0);
assert_eq!(bag.remaining, 250.0);
assert_eq!(
bag.roast_date,
Some(NaiveDate::from_ymd_opt(2023, 1, 1).unwrap())
);
}
#[tokio::test]
async fn creating_a_bag_without_auth_returns_401() {
// Arrange
let app = spawn_app().await; // No auth
let client = reqwest::Client::new();
// We can't easily create a roast without auth, so we'll just try to create a bag
// with a dummy ID. The auth check should happen before validation.
let new_bag = serde_json::json!({
"roast_id": 123,
"amount": 250.0
});
// Act
let response = client
.post(app.api_url("/bags"))
.json(&new_bag)
.send()
.await
.expect("Failed to execute request");
// Assert
assert_eq!(response.status(), 401);
}
#[tokio::test]
async fn listing_bags_returns_200_and_correct_data() {
// Arrange
let app = spawn_app_with_auth().await;
let roaster = create_default_roaster(&app).await;
let roast = create_default_roast(&app, roaster.id).await;
let client = reqwest::Client::new();
// Create a bag
let new_bag = NewBag {
roast_id: roast.id,
roast_date: None,
amount: 500.0,
};
client
.post(app.api_url("/bags"))
.bearer_auth(app.auth_token.as_ref().unwrap())
.json(&new_bag)
.send()
.await
.expect("Failed to create bag");
// Act
let response = client
.get(app.api_url(&format!("/bags?roast_id={}", roast.id)))
.send()
.await
.expect("Failed to execute request");
// Assert
assert_eq!(response.status(), 200);
let bags: Vec<BagWithRoast> = response.json().await.expect("Failed to parse response");
assert_eq!(bags.len(), 1);
assert_eq!(bags[0].bag.amount, 500.0);
assert_eq!(bags[0].roast_name, roast.name);
}
#[tokio::test]
async fn getting_a_bag_returns_200_for_valid_id() {
// Arrange
let app = spawn_app_with_auth().await;
let roaster = create_default_roaster(&app).await;
let roast = create_default_roast(&app, roaster.id).await;
let client = reqwest::Client::new();
let new_bag = NewBag {
roast_id: roast.id,
roast_date: None,
amount: 250.0,
};
let create_response = client
.post(app.api_url("/bags"))
.bearer_auth(app.auth_token.as_ref().unwrap())
.json(&new_bag)
.send()
.await
.expect("Failed to create bag");
let created_bag: Bag = create_response
.json()
.await
.expect("Failed to parse response");
// Act
let response = client
.get(app.api_url(&format!("/bags/{}", created_bag.id)))
.send()
.await
.expect("Failed to execute request");
// Assert
assert_eq!(response.status(), 200);
let bag: Bag = response.json().await.expect("Failed to parse response");
assert_eq!(bag.id, created_bag.id);
}
#[tokio::test]
async fn updating_a_bag_returns_200_and_updates_data() {
// Arrange
let app = spawn_app_with_auth().await;
let roaster = create_default_roaster(&app).await;
let roast = create_default_roast(&app, roaster.id).await;
let client = reqwest::Client::new();
let new_bag = NewBag {
roast_id: roast.id,
roast_date: None,
amount: 250.0,
};
let create_response = client
.post(app.api_url("/bags"))
.bearer_auth(app.auth_token.as_ref().unwrap())
.json(&new_bag)
.send()
.await
.expect("Failed to create bag");
let created_bag: Bag = create_response
.json()
.await
.expect("Failed to parse response");
let update_payload = UpdateBag {
remaining: Some(100.0),
closed: Some(true),
finished_at: Some(NaiveDate::from_ymd_opt(2023, 2, 1).unwrap()),
};
// Act
let response = client
.put(app.api_url(&format!("/bags/{}", created_bag.id)))
.bearer_auth(app.auth_token.as_ref().unwrap())
.json(&update_payload)
.send()
.await
.expect("Failed to execute request");
// Assert
assert_eq!(response.status(), 200);
let updated_bag: Bag = response.json().await.expect("Failed to parse response");
assert_eq!(updated_bag.remaining, 100.0);
assert!(updated_bag.closed);
assert_eq!(
updated_bag.finished_at,
Some(NaiveDate::from_ymd_opt(2023, 2, 1).unwrap())
);
}
#[tokio::test]
async fn deleting_a_bag_returns_204() {
// Arrange
let app = spawn_app_with_auth().await;
let roaster = create_default_roaster(&app).await;
let roast = create_default_roast(&app, roaster.id).await;
let client = reqwest::Client::new();
let new_bag = NewBag {
roast_id: roast.id,
roast_date: None,
amount: 250.0,
};
let create_response = client
.post(app.api_url("/bags"))
.bearer_auth(app.auth_token.as_ref().unwrap())
.json(&new_bag)
.send()
.await
.expect("Failed to create bag");
let created_bag: Bag = create_response
.json()
.await
.expect("Failed to parse response");
// Act
let response = client
.delete(app.api_url(&format!("/bags/{}", created_bag.id)))
.bearer_auth(app.auth_token.as_ref().unwrap())
.send()
.await
.expect("Failed to execute request");
// Assert
assert_eq!(response.status(), 204);
// Verify deletion
let get_response = client
.get(app.api_url(&format!("/bags/{}", created_bag.id)))
.send()
.await
.expect("Failed to execute request");
assert_eq!(get_response.status(), 404);
}
